# create-dev-task

Generate a development task document for the Dev agent to implement based on validated issue and investigation.

## When to Use

- After QA or Support has validated and investigated an issue
- When a bug needs to be assigned to the Dev agent
- Before sprint planning to prepare development specifications
- When creating fix specifications from customer-reported issues

## Quick Start

1. Gather investigation results (validation report, root cause, affected components)
2. Create dev task document with problem statement
3. Define fix requirements (functional and non-functional)
4. Add risk assessment and deployment considerations
5. Package handoff notes for Dev agent

## Purpose

Create a comprehensive development task that describes WHAT needs fixing and WHY, not HOW to code it. The Dev agent will use this specification to implement the actual fix.

### 5. Risk and Impact Assessment

```yaml
risk_assessment:
  fix_complexity:
    low: "Single line/simple logic change"
    medium: "Multiple files, moderate logic"
    high: "Architecture change, multiple services"
    
  regression_risk:
    low: "Isolated feature, good test coverage"
    medium: "Shared component, some dependencies"
    high: "Core functionality, many dependencies"
    
  deployment_risk:
    low: "Feature flag available, easy rollback"
    medium: "Standard deployment, monitoring needed"
    high: "Database changes, careful coordination"
```
